How they compare

Dominica currently reports 29.78 million BoP, current US$ against 24.24 million BoP, current US$ in Samoa, a difference of 5.54 million BoP, current US$.

That makes Dominica's figure about 1.2 times Samoa's.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 45 shared years of data; in 1977 it was Samoa ahead.

Dominica ranks 190th and Samoa ranks 193rd of 199 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Dominica averaged higher in 3 and Samoa in 3.

Head to head by decade

Decade Dominica Samoa Difference Ahead
1970s 12.57 million BoP, current US$ 14.20 million BoP, current US$ 1.63 million BoP, current US$ Samoa
1980s 33.39 million BoP, current US$ 14.39 million BoP, current US$ 19.01 million BoP, current US$ Dominica
1990s 53.55 million BoP, current US$ 10.74 million BoP, current US$ 42.81 million BoP, current US$ Dominica
2000s 41.63 million BoP, current US$ 11.82 million BoP, current US$ 29.81 million BoP, current US$ Dominica
2010s 28.31 million BoP, current US$ 33.06 million BoP, current US$ 4.75 million BoP, current US$ Samoa
2020s 25.46 million BoP, current US$ 36.33 million BoP, current US$ 10.87 million BoP, current US$ Samoa

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Exports of goods occur when there are changes in the economic ownership of goods from residents of the compiling economy to non-residents, irrespective of physical movement of goods across national borders.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
